Ingredients

Main Ingredients

- 12 Medjool dates, pitted

- 1/2 cup creamy peanut butter

- 1/4 cup dark chocolate chips (optional for chocolate lovers)

- 1 tablespoon coconut oil (to enhance chocolate coating, optional)

- Sea salt for a final sprinkle

- Chopped nuts or granola for a delightful crunch (optional)

Equipment Needed

- Mixing bowl

- Spoon or piping bag

- Microwave-safe bowl

- Baking sheet

- Parchment paper

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paring the Dates

To start, take your Medjool dates and slice them carefully down the middle. Do not cut all the way through; aim for a pocket to hold your filling. This step is key. The pocket will keep the peanut butter from spilling out.

Filling and Dipping

Next, grab a mixing bowl and add your creamy peanut butter. Stir until it is smooth. If you like crunch, mix in chopped nuts or granola. This adds a fun texture. If you choose to use chocolate, melt the dark chocolate chips with coconut oil in a microwave-safe bowl. Heat it in 30-second bursts, stirring in between. You want a smooth, shiny blend.

Assembling the Treats

Now, fill each date with about 1 tablespoon of peanut butter. Use a small spoon or piping bag for this. Gently squeeze the sides of the date to hold the filling inside. If you melted chocolate, dip each date halfway into it. Let any extra chocolate drip back into the bowl. Place the dipped dates on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Right after dipping, sprinkle a pinch of sea salt on top. This enhances the flavor. Chill the dates in the fridge for about 30 minutes, allowing the chocolate to set. Enjoy your sweet, chewy bites!

Tips & Tricks

Perfecting the Filling

To avoid a messy filling, work with room-temperature peanut butter. It spreads easily this way. Use a small spoon or piping bag for filling. This keeps the peanut butter neat inside the date. If you want more flavor, try adding a pinch of cinnamon or vanilla extract. These enhance the peanut butter taste and make it even more delicious.

Chocolate Dipping Techniques

For melting chocolate, use a microwave-safe bowl. Heat the chocolate in 30-second bursts. Stir well between each burst until it is smooth. This helps prevent burning. When dipping, hold each date by the sides. Dip halfway into the chocolate, letting excess drip back. This keeps the coating even and neat.

Variations

Alternative Fillings

You can use other nut butters, like almond or cashew, instead of peanut butter. Each nut brings a new flavor. Adding fruit like banana or dried cranberries can make it sweeter. You can also try spices like cinnamon or a pinch of sea salt for an extra kick. These simple changes make your snack exciting and fun.

Dietary Modifications

If you want a vegan option, choose plant-based chocolate. Many brands offer tasty vegan chocolate that works well. For gluten-free options, just check the chocolate and nut butter labels. Most are naturally gluten-free, making this treat safe for everyone.

Storage Info

How to Store Stuffed Dates

To keep your stuffed dates fresh, use an airtight container. Glass or plastic containers work well. Store them in the fridge for the best taste. The cool air helps maintain their flavor and texture.

Shelf Life

Stuffed dates last about one week in the fridge. Check for signs of spoilage. If they smell off or look dry, it's best to toss them. Fresh dates should be soft, sweet, and chewy.

Freezing for Later Use

You can freeze stuffed dates for longer storage.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et. Freeze them for about two hours. Once frozen, transfer them to an airtight container.

When you're ready to eat, thaw them in the fridge overnight. For a quick thaw, let them s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es. Enjoy your tasty treats even later!

Can you use other types of dates?

You can use other types of dates, but Medjool dates are best. They are:

- Soft and chewy, making them easy to fill.

- Naturally sweet, enhancing the overall flavor.

- Larger, providing more space for the filling.

Other varieties, like Deglet Noor, work too, but may be less sweet and smaller.

What can I substitute for peanut butter?

If you want to substitute peanut butter, try these options:

- Almond butter for a different nutty flavor.

- Cashew butter for a creamier texture.

- Sunflower seed butter for a nut-free alternative.

- Tahini for a unique taste with a hint of sesame.

These substitutes can fit various dietary needs and taste preferences.
